Zusammenfassung: | PURPOSE:To make it possible to obtain a clear quantitative analysis curve, by reducing As contained in specimen water collected from factory waste water to As and passing the treated specimen water through activated carbon. CONSTITUTION:Specimen water weighed by a weighing tube 4 is introduced into a measuring cell 8 and HCl and KI are injected in said cell 8 from a line 2 and the resulting solution mixture is stirred for about 15min by a stirrer 9 while nitrogen gas is passed through said solution mixture to reduce As in the specimen water to As. Next, the specimen water after reduction is stagnated in a bottle 1 while the specimen water weighing tube 4 and the measuring cell 8 are washed and the specimen water in the bottle 1 is passed through an activated carbon bed 14 to be returned to the measuring cell 8 while the removal of inhibiting components is performed. At this time, a definite amount of an aqueous CuSO4 solution is introduced into the measuring cell 8 in addition and Cu and As is adhered to a suspended mercury droplet electrode by electrodeposition to perform polarography. |
